BATMAN ETERNAL #2 Review

Posted on the 16 April 2014 by Geekasms @geekasms

Oh. My. Lord. This chapter made me have a Geekasm.  What did we do to deserve such awesomeness?

Starting out, we have Mayor Sebastian Hady talking with a mysterious man. Who is it?!? Vicki Vale gets strong armed into posting the story that Gordon was arrested.  This sets off the series of panels that just spews the greatness that will come from this series.  We see Batgirl, Harper Row, Red Hood, Lucius Fox, Batwoman and Red Robin all on a single spread. Ummm, yes!  Batman knows that Gordon is innocent and needs to figure out how and why this whole debacle happened.  We get teased some more with different villains popping up.  Some old.  Some not so popular. Some are just unexpected.   Low and behold Batman makes a discovery and it scares him.  Yes, scares Batman.  Who could be in town that has Batman’s “tights in a bunch”?

I am EXTREMELY glad I decided to read this series.  It might seem like a no brainer if you know me but books cost money and this being a standard price book AND weekly, it will add up.  I am making sacrifices to read Batman just like he does for Gotham.  I am a fan of Scott Snyder and I am becoming a big fan of Jason Fabok’s work.  This is the epitome of a killer creative team. Exciting book from start to finish and has me wanting more.  If Batman was a drug, this series would be my fix.

Batman Eternal #2

Story and Script by:  Scott Snyder & James T Tynion IV
Consulting Writers: Ray Fawkes, John Layman & Tim Seeley
Art by: Jason Fabok
Colors by: Brad Anderson
Lettering by: Nick J. Napolitano
